إعداد مشروعك على Google Cloud

يعرض هذا الدليل كيفية إعداد مشروعك على Google Cloud قبل استخدام واجهات برمجة التطبيقات على "منصة خرائط Google". من المحتمل أن تكون قد أكملت بعض هذه الخطوات في صفحة بدء استخدام "منصة خرائط Google"، ولكن يقدّم هذا الموضوع تعليمات إضافية مفيدة بشأن إدارة مشاريعك.

إنشاء مشروع

لاستخدام "منصة خرائط Google"، يجب أن يكون لديك مشروع لإدارة الخدمات وبيانات الاعتماد والفوترة وواجهات برمجة التطبيقات وحزم SDK.

يُعدّ إعداد الفوترة مطلوبًا لكل مشروع، ولكن لن يتم تحصيل رسوم منك إلا إذا تجاوز المشروع حصة الخدمات المجانية.

لإنشاء مشروع على السحابة الإلكترونية تم تفعيل الفوترة فيه:

وحدة التحكّم

  1. إنشاء مشروع Google Cloud جديد في Cloud Console:

    إنشاء مشروع جديد
  2. في صفحة المشروع الجديد، املأ المعلومات المطلوبة:

    • اسم المشروع: يمكنك قبول الاسم التلقائي أو إدخال اسم مخصّص.

      يمكنك تغيير اسم المشروع في أي وقت. لمزيد من المعلومات، راجِع تحديد المشاريع.

    • رقم تعريف المشروع: اقبل القيمة التلقائية أو انقر على تعديل لإدخال رقم تعريف مخصّص تستخدمه Google APIs كمعرّف فريد لمشروعك.

      بعد إنشاء المشروع، لا يمكنك تغيير رقم تعريف المشروع، لذا اختَر رقم تعريف ترغب في استخدامه طوال مدة المشروع. يُرجى عدم إدراج أي معلومات حسّاسة في رقم تعريف مشروعك.

    • حساب الفوترة: اختَر حساب فوترة للمشروع. في حال عدم إعداد حساب فوترة أو امتلاك حساب فوترة واحد فقط، لن يظهر لك هذا الخيار.

      يجب أن تكون مشرف حساب الفوترة أو مدير فوترة المشروع لربط مشروع بحساب فوترة. لمزيد من المعلومات، راجِع مستندات التحكّم في الوصول إلى الفوترة.

    • الموقع الجغرافي: إذا كانت لديك مؤسسة تريد ربط مشروعك بها، انقر على تصفّح واختَره، وإلا اختَر "بدون مؤسسة".

      لمزيد من المعلومات، راجِع إنشاء المجلدات وإدارتها والعلاقات بين المؤسسات والمشاريع وحسابات الفوترة.

  3. انقر على إنشاء.

gcloud

gcloud projects create "PROJECT"

اطّلِع على مزيد من المعلومات عن حزمة تطوير برامج Google Cloud SDK و تثبيت حزمة تطوير برامج Google Cloud والطلبات التالية:

تفعيل الفوترة

لنشر تطبيقاتك، عليك تفعيل الفوترة. لن يتم تحصيل رسوم من حسابك إذا بقيت في نطاق الحصة الشهرية. إذا كان تطبيقك يحتاج إلى موارد تتجاوز الحصة الشهرية، سيتم تحصيل رسوم منك مقابل الاستخدام الإضافي.

إذا كان لديك حساب فوترة عند إنشاء مشروع على السحابة الإلكترونية، سيتم تفعيل الفوترة تلقائيًا في هذا المشروع.

لتفعيل الفوترة في مشروع على السحابة الإلكترونية:

  1. في Cloud Console، انتقِل إلى صفحة "الفوترة":
    الانتقال إلى صفحة "الفوترة"
  2. اختَر أو أنشئ مشروعًا على السحابة الإلكترونية.
  3. استنادًا إلى ما إذا كان هناك حساب فوترة أو إذا كان المشروع الذي تم اختياره على Cloud مرتبطًا بحساب، تعرض صفحة الفوترة أحد الخيارات التالية:
    • إذا سبق أن تم تفعيل الفوترة للمشروع المحدّد على Cloud، سيتم إدراج تفاصيل حساب الفوترة.
    • في حال عدم توفّر أي حساب فوترة، سيُطلب منك إنشاء حساب فوترة وربطه بمشروع Cloud المحدّد.
    • إذا كان هناك حساب فوترة، سيُطلب منك تفعيل الفوترة إذا لم يكن المشروع على السحابة الإلكترونية المحدّد مرتبطًا بحساب فوترة. يمكنك أيضًا اختيار إلغاء ثم اختيار إنشاء حساب لإنشاء حساب فوترة جديد وربطه.

بعد تفعيل الفوترة، ليس هناك حدّ أقصى للمبلغ الذي قد يتم تحصيله منك. للتحكّم بشكلٍ أفضل في التكاليف، يمكنك إنشاء ميزانية وتحديد التنبيهات. ولمزيد من المعلومات، اطّلِع على الفوترة.

تفعيل واجهات برمجة التطبيقات

لاستخدام "منصة خرائط Google"، يجب تفعيل واجهات برمجة التطبيقات أو حِزم تطوير البرامج (SDK) التي تنوي استخدامها مع مشروعك.

وحدة التحكّم

تفعيل Maps JavaScript API

Cloud SDK

gcloud services enable \
    --project "PROJECT" \
    "maps-backend.googleapis.com"

اطّلِع على مزيد من المعلومات عن حزمة تطوير برامج Google Cloud SDK و تثبيت حزمة تطوير برامج Google Cloud والطلبات التالية:

عرض واجهات برمجة التطبيقات المفعّلة

وحدة التحكّم

للاطّلاع على واجهات برمجة التطبيقات أو حِزم تطوير البرامج (SDK) التي تم تفعيلها، انتقِل إلى صفحة "منصة خرائط Google" في Cloud Console:

الانتقال إلى صفحة "منصة خرائط Google"
  • واجهات برمجة تطبيقات إضافية: لم يتم تفعيل واجهات برمجة التطبيقات أو حِزم تطوير البرامج (SDK).
  • إذا ظهرت لك بطاقات لكل واجهة برمجة تطبيقات وخدمات للخريطة، هذا يعني أنه لم يتم تفعيل واجهات برمجة تطبيقات أو حِزم تطوير برامج (SDK).

gcloud

gcloud services list --project "PROJECT"

اطّلِع على مزيد من المعلومات عن حزمة تطوير برامج Google Cloud SDK و تثبيت حزمة تطوير برامج Google Cloud والطلبات التالية:

إيقاف تشغيل مشروع

يمكنك إيقاف الفوترة وإصدار جميع موارد Cloud المُستخدَمة في مشروعك على السحابة الإلكترونية من خلال إيقاف المشروع.

وحدة التحكّم

  1. انتقِل إلى صفحة "المشاريع":

    الانتقال إلى صفحة "المشاريع"
  2. اختَر المشروع على السحابة الإلكترونية الذي تريد إيقافه، ثم انقر على حذف.

لمزيد من المعلومات حول إدارة مشاريعك على Cloud، يُرجى الاطّلاع على مقالة مدير موارد Cloud: إنشاء المشاريع وإيقافها وإيقافها واستعادتها.

gcloud

gcloud projects delete "PROJECT"

اطّلِع على مزيد من المعلومات عن حزمة تطوير برامج Google Cloud SDK و تثبيت حزمة تطوير برامج Google Cloud والطلبات التالية:

الخطوات التالية

بعد إعداد مشروع Google Cloud، يجب إنشاء مفتاح واجهة برمجة التطبيقات وتأمينه لاستخدام API للخرائط في JavaScript:

استخدام مفاتيح واجهة برمجة التطبيقات